#fff6c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fff6c3 is composed of 100% red, 96.5%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.5% magenta, 23.5%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 51 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 88.2%. #fff6c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ffed87.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

● #fff6c3 color description : Very pale yellow.
#fff6c3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fff6c3 has RGB values of R:255, G:246,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.24, K:0. Its decimal value is 16774851.
